Calculating Home Energy Efficiency
How efficiently is your home using energy? Calculating home energy efficiency is essential to understanding where you can cut back on power consumption.
With the increasing adoption of electric vehicles reducing greenhouse gas emissions, homeowners can further reduce their carbon footprint by optimizing their home's energy performance.
Energy efficiency metrics, such as the Home Energy Rating System (HERS) index, provide a detailed score of your home's energy performance.
A residential energy audit is an extensive assessment of your home's energy usage, identifying areas of improvement and opportunities for energy savings.
By analyzing your energy usage patterns, you can identify areas where energy is being wasted and take corrective action.
With this knowledge, you can optimize your home's energy efficiency, reducing your energy bills and environmental impact.

Home Energy Audit on Demand
Through the convenience of energy-saving apps, homeowners can now access a home energy audit on demand, eliminating the need for a physical visit from an energy auditor.
This feature allows you to assess your home's energy efficiency from the comfort of your own home. You'll reap the energy audit benefits, including identifying areas of energy waste and opportunities for improvement, without the hassle and cost of a traditional audit.
- Take photos of your home's electrical panels, insulation, and windows to assess their energy efficiency.
- Answer questions about your home's energy usage habits and appliances.
- Use DIY audit techniques to detect air leaks and inspect your HVAC system.
- Receive a personalized report outlining recommendations for energy-saving improvements.

Optimizing Home Energy Usage Patterns
One of the most significant advantages of energy-saving apps is their ability to help you optimize your home energy usage patterns. By analyzing your energy consumption habits, these apps can identify areas of inefficiency and provide you with actionable observations to make changes.
For instance:
- You can adjust your smart thermostat usage to reduce energy waste during periods of inactivity or when you're not home.
- You can identify which appliances are consuming the most energy and consider replacing them with energy-efficient alternatives.
- You can optimize your lighting usage by switching to energy-efficient bulbs or installing smart lighting systems.
- You can even schedule energy-intensive tasks, like laundry or dishwashing, during off-peak hours when energy rates are lower.
